When you’re ready to explore the area, there’s plenty to do on the mountain and in nearby Government Camp. You’ll be about a half mile from downtown, where there’s an array of restaurants, shops, and amenities (and ski rental places!).
For skiing, snowboarding, inner-tubing, and more, Ski Bowl is about a half mile from the home. It’s also the best place for night skiing, which is always a fun activity; you can gaze out at the stars above when riding the chair lift, then enjoy a less crowded run down the mountain. Timberline Ski Resort above historic Timberline Lodge is only six miles away, and because its slopes are open throughout the year, you can all seasons skiing. Mt. Hood Meadows is under 12 miles away and offers an array of terrain, from beginner bunny slopes to black diamond runs for experts.
In the summer, Mt. Hood Meadows also offers plenty of summer activities, including scenic hiking, chairlift rides, and more. For summer skiing and snowboarding, Timberline Ski Area has a small number of snow-filled runs for those looking to hit the powder year-round.
